RoboHelp HTML5 output not working on current iPhones, iPads, Macs
I recently noticed that my HTML5 output wasn't working on iPhone, iPad, and macOS Safari.
First I thought something was wrong with my own scripts, but after some digging, I found that it's a bug in the native RH JS files.
That means that none of your HTML5 RoboHelp projects will work properly on current iPhones, iPads, and Macs (= devices running iOS 10 or macOS Sierra).
This is a major bug that should be addressed as soon as possible. The bug has already been filed by Alexandra Duffy one month ago, but it is still "Unverified": Bug#4192629 - Safari 10 update has caused HTML5 Help from RH to stop working.
Luckily enough, Edward Doris has already posted a bugfix in the above bug report. It seems to solve the problem on all devices. However, implementing the bugfix requires advanced JS knowledge.
Please provide an official bugfix as soon as possible.
